【题目】 Are you shyIf you areyou are not alone. In factclose to 50 percent of people are shy. Almost 80 percent of people fell shy at some point in their lives. These daysshyness is becoming more and more common. Nowscientists are trying to understand shyness. They have some interesting ideas about why people are shy.

Is it possible to be born shyMany scientists say yes. They say 15 to 20 percent of babies behave shyly. These babies are a little quieter and more watchful than other babies. Interestinglythese shy babies usually have shy parents. As a resultscientists think that some shyness is genetic.

Family size might cause people to be shy as well. Scientists at Harvard University studied shy children. They found that 66 percent of them had older brothers and sisters. The scientists said that these children were often bullied(欺负)by their older brothers and sisters. As a resultthey became shy. At the same timechildren with no brothers and sisters may be shy as well. Growing up alonethey often play by themselves. They are not able to learn the same social skills as children from big families.

You may also be shy because of where you were born. When scientists studied shyness in different countriesthey found surprising differences. In Japanmost people said they were shy. But in Israelonly one of three people said so. What explains the differenceOne scientist says the Japanese and Israelis have different opinions of failure. In Japanwhen people do not succeedthey feel bad about themselves. They blame(责备)themselves for their failure. In Israelthe opposite is true. Israelis often blame failure on outside reasonssuch as familyteachersfriends or bad luck. In Israelfreedom of opinion and risk taking are strongly supported. This may be why Israelis worry less about failure and are less shy.

For shy peopleit can be difficult to make friendsspeak in classand even get a good job. But scientists say you can get over your shyness. They suggest trying new things and practicing conversations. And don’t forget-if you are shyyou are not the only one.

【题目】I was going back to work to finish a few things one evening, and my two children were busy sewing (缝纫) things on the sewing machine. My 11-year-old daughter was going to help her older brother make a little cushion (抱枕). I left and in a few hours returned to find a mess in the kitchen and front room while both children were sitting in front of the television. Having had a long day, I was very short with my greeting to them. But then I noticed the material they had used for the cushion. I had bought it to make a blanket. Not stopping to listen to them, I shouted at the children and explained how angry I was at what they had done.

My daughter listened to me timidly, not trying to say anything for herself at all, but the pain could be seen on her face. She went to her room quietly and spent some time alone before she came out to say good night and once again apologize for the mistake she had made. A few hours later, as I was preparing to go to bed, there on my bed lying a beautiful little cushion, with the words “I LOVE MOM”. Next to it was a note apologizing again.

To this day, I still get tears in my eyes when I think of how I reacted and still feel the pain of my actions. I then went to my daughter and apologized for my actions. I display the cushion on my bed with great pride and use it as a reminder that nothing in this world is greater than a child's love.
